AI predicts next 20 Ballon d’Or winners: Yamal’s Real Madrid move and the rise of the ‘New Messi’

A groundbreaking artificial intelligence (AI) prediction has forecast the next 20 Ballon d’Or winners, sparking significant debate and fueling speculation. The most surprising predictions involve Barcelona’s Lamine Yamal, who is projected to win three awards, including two while playing for Real Madrid, and the emergence of an unnamed Argentinian player, born in 2020, dubbed “The New Messi.”

This AI forecast highlights the unpredictable nature of soccer careers while showcasing AI’s potential for analyzing historical trends and predicting future outcomes.

Predicting future Ballon d’Or winners is an inherently challenging task. The dynamic nature of football, with its unpredictable variables (injuries, form fluctuations, managerial changes, and unexpected career shifts), makes accurate long-term forecasting nearly impossible. However, a recent AI-powered prediction, published by Transfermarkt, offers a unique perspective on potential future trends.

This projection, encompassing the next 20 Ballon d’Or winners (2025-2044), uses sophisticated data analysis and algorithms to identify patterns and forecast future dominance across various global leagues. The most controversial and intriguing aspects of this projection focus on the future of Barcelona’s Lamine Yamal and the anticipated emergence of a player deemed “The New Messi.”

A fusion of established stars and emerging talents

The AI’s projections showcase a blend of current stars and promising young talents. Kylian Mbappé (2025), Erling Haaland (2026), and Vinicius Junior (2027) lead the way, reflecting their current dominance and established reputations. This initial phase of the prediction is relatively predictable, but the long-term forecasts become significantly more speculative. Jude Bellingham, Florian Wirtz, and Julián Álvarez are also included.

The AI’s boldest prediction involves Barcelona’s Lamine Yamal, projected to win three Ballon d’Or awards. One of these wins (2029) is predicted during his time at Barcelona. However, two additional awards (2035 and 2037) are forecast to be won while playing for Real Madrid.

This prediction, suggesting a future transfer to their fiercest rivals, is the most debated aspect of the AI’s forecast. The prediction highlights the ever-evolving nature of professional football, with young players often changing clubs and seeking new challenges throughout their careers. This particular prediction, however, will likely fuel much debate and speculation amongst fans of both teams.
